We'll create fresh WordPress site with WP Recent Posts installed. You have 20 minutes to test the plugin after that site we'll be deleted.
This plugin will allow you to display recent posts with date, excerpt and title in Posts, Pages, Widgets and custom post types. You have to add [wp_recent_posts] shortcode to display recent posts.
Kindly let us know your feedback or comments to add more features in this plugin.
Basic shortcode
Display recent 5 posts
[wp_recent_posts count='5']